West End Markets
Saturday, 3 May 2025, 6am - 2pm

West End Markets

A weekly community event featuring music with fresh produce and healthy fast food, fashion and gifts under a canopy of glorious giant fig trees. Davies Park Market West End has a wide array of products and produce that you won’t find anywhere else in Brisbane.

Manly Creative Markets
Sunday, 4 May 2025, 8am - 2pm

Manly Creative Markets

The Manly Creative Markets operates Every Sunday (except when Christmas Day is on a Sunday!) from 8am until 2pm, as an alternative retail outlet for local and regional creative talent, and is definitely not a flea market.  You will find artisan wares, arts & crafts, plants,  great coffee, entertainment, massage, fashion, pet items and so much more at the Manly Creative Markets in Little Bayside Park every Sunday. Free parking in the surrounding streets.

Jan Power Manly Markets
Saturday, 17 May 2025, 6am - 12pm

Jan Power Manly Markets

The Jan Powers Farmers Markets deliver the perfect package: premium quality products, friendly and knowledgeable stallholders and one of the most picturesque locations in Brisbane. The waterfront markets are held on the first and third Saturday of each month within the lush greenery of Little Bayside Park and against the beautiful backdrop of Manly Harbour. Bask in the warm Queensland sunshine and enjoy the gentle bay breezes as you wander through a vibrant mini-village of fresh produce, delicious food and carefully crafted treats. Each stallholder is passionate about their products and loves nothing more than sharing their stories and offering expert advice and tips to market shoppers. Plenty of off street parking.

2025 Paniyiri Greek Festival
Saturday, 17 May - Sunday, 18 May 2025

2025 Paniyiri Greek Festival

The largest cultural festival in Queensland, and the longest running Greek festival in the country, the Paniyiri Greek Festival, returns to Musgrave Park in South Brisbane on Saturday May 17 and Sunday May 18, 2025 with tickets now on sale. The Paniyiri Greek Festival is a two-day multi-sensory experience where people of all ages and abilities and background are encouraged to dance the Zorba, learn mediterranean cooking, taste Greek wines, cheer on the plate smashers, shop the market stalls, enjoy a non-stop lineup of entertainment while dining on the huge variety of authentic savoury or sweet dishes from multiple food stalls representing 11 different Greek regions. The year’s festival will return with everyone’s favourites, along with some exciting new additions including the opportunity to pre-book a “Paniyiri Greek Mezze Box”. Experience all the colours and flavours of Greece with this grazing box, a new convenient festival offering showcasing an authentic home-made mezze mix, including keftethes, spanakopita, taramasalata, tzatziki, kalamata olives with Yiayia’s secret marinate, locally produced feta and, of course, pita bread. Purchases of Greek Mezze Box includes exclusive access to the exclusive seating area on Saturday between 12pm – 4pm. The seating area has priority viewing of the Main Stage, premium furniture, limited bar facilities and shade. Seating is limited and subject to availability until capacity is reached. There is also the option of a special “add on” festival picnic rug! The Greek Mezze box and picnic rug must ordered online before 12 May when purchasing your ticket.
